Medusa icon

Medusa

Launch and manage your online business effortlessly with a customizable solution that grows with your needs

Medusa - A flexible and customizable eCommerce platform designed for scalability and personalization

Medusa is an open-source composable commerce platform built on Node.js, tailored to meet the diverse needs of modern businesses. Its core features include multi-channel selling capabilities, allowing merchants to sell across various platforms such as social media, marketplaces, or physical stores from a single inventory system. The platform supports advanced product management with custom attributes, enabling detailed descriptions of products. Additionally, it provides robust security measures like secure credit card storage and fraud detection, ensuring compliance with PCI standards.

In addition to its core functionalities, Medusa boasts a rich ecosystem of plugins and extensions that enhance functionality further. Users can integrate third-party services seamlessly into their e-commerce solution using Medusa’s API-first approach. This flexibility allows developers to build bespoke experiences by choosing only the necessary modules and integrating them easily without rebuilding the entire platform. With its scalable design, Medusa handles high traffic volumes efficiently during peak periods while maintaining performance speed.

Key features

  • Modular Architecture: Interchangeable modules for specific functionalities.
  • Multi-Channel Selling: Sell across multiple sales channels including social media and marketplaces.
  • Custom Product Attributes: Detailed description support through custom attributes.
  • Secure Credit Card Storage & Fraud Detection: Ensures PCI compliance with robust security measures.
  • API-First Approach: Seamless integration with third-party services via APIs.
  • Extensive Plugin Ecosystem: Access thousands of plugins for extending store capabilities.
  • Scalable Design: Handles high traffic volumes efficiently during peaks.

Best use cases

  • Enterprise-Level Businesses: Scalable solutions for large-scale operations requiring customized features.
  • Global Market Expansion: Easily manage international customers with multilingual support.
  • High-Traffic Events: Maintain performance during sudden spikes in traffic.

Pros & cons

  • ✅ Highly Customizable Platform Meets Specific Business Needs.
  • ✅ Strong Community Support Provides Resources for Troubleshooting and Development.
  • ✅ Extensive Module Marketplace Enhances Store Capabilities Without Coding Expertise Required.
  • ✅ Built-In Security Measures Ensure Compliance with Industry Standards Like PCI.
  • ✅ Flexible Integration Options Allow Developers To Choose Necessary Modules Only.
  • ✅ Active Development Community Contributes Continuously Improving The Platform.
  • ❌ Initial Setup May Require Technical Knowledge For Optimal Configuration.
  • ❌ Some Advanced Features May Incure Additional Costs Or Premium Subscriptions Needed.
  • ❄️ Performance Can Vary Based On Hosting Solutions Chosen By Users.

Repository details

  • Stars

    26045
  • Forks

    2624
  • Open Issues

    208
  • Closed Issues

    2147
  • Last commit

    an hour ago
  • License

Data fetched at Nov 22, 2024 14:11 UTC

Languages

TypeScript (86%)
JavaScript (13%)
Medusa is fully open-source, meaning that the whole software codes are available in public.
Muhammad Syakirurohman Made by
Muhammad Syakirurohman
Category icons are designed by Freepik
Copyright © 2024 AlternateOSS